Understanding Scale Formation in Pipes
Scale buildup occurs when minerals from certain sources precipitate out of solution and adhere to surfaces, primarily in pipelines. This phenomenon can lead to various complications, significantly affecting the efficiency and functionality of these structures.
- Common minerals contributing to scale formation include calcium and magnesium.
- The process is often exacerbated by elevated temperatures and prolonged exposure to these minerals.
Over time, the accumulation of scale can restrict flow, reducing overall performance. The following points highlight why understanding this process is crucial for maintenance:
- Efficiency Loss: Restriction caused by buildup can lead to increased energy consumption as pumps work harder to move fluids.
- Potential Damage: Scale can cause wear and tear on system components, leading to increased maintenance costs.
- Reduced Lifespan: Structures may experience decreased longevity due to the corrosive effects of accumulated minerals.
Utilizing water softeners can be an effective strategy in mitigating scale development. These devices help in converting hard minerals into softer forms, thereby minimizing the likelihood of build-up and preserving the integrity of pipelines.
Addressing scale accumulation proactively can ensure optimal performance and enhance the overall durability of infrastructure.
Identifying Signs of Hard Water Damage in Plumbing Fixtures
Recognizing the consequences of mineral-rich liquid on your internal fixtures is crucial for maintaining their functionality. Common indicators of mineral accumulation include cloudy spots on glass surfaces, particularly in dishware and shower doors. This visual impairment often results from deposits that form as the liquid evaporates.
Another key sign is the presence of white or chalky residues around faucets, showerheads, and in sinks. These residues signify that mineral buildup is occurring, which can lead to reduced water flow over time. Homeowners should also be cautious of frequent clogs, as scale buildup within pipes can hinder proper drainage.
Moreover, decreased pressure in faucets or showers can suggest that internal passages are narrowing due to accumulated deposits. Regular inspections can help identify these issues early, allowing for easier maintenance and the potential use of water softeners to mitigate further damage.
Finally, if you notice a metallic or unusual taste in your drinking supply, it might indicate that mineral content is affecting the overall quality of your household’s fluid. Taking action upon witnessing these signs can help preserve the integrity of your fixtures for years to come.

Repairing and Maintaining Fixtures Affected by Hard Water
Addressing scale buildup caused by mineral deposits is crucial for preserving the longevity and efficiency of your fixtures. Repairing and maintaining systems that suffer from hard water effects involves a series of steps aimed at removing existing deposits and preventing future issues.
The first step in rectifying damage is to accurately assess the extent of scale accumulation. Regular inspections can help pinpoint affected areas, ensuring timely intervention. If you notice reduced water flow or inconsistent temperatures, these may signal the need for immediate action.
Common methods for scale removal include using specialized descaling agents or vinegar solutions. Applying these solutions can effectively dissolve mineral buildup. It’s essential to follow up with a thorough rinse to ensure no residues remain that could contribute to additional issues.
Incorporating water softeners can also play a pivotal role in both repair and maintenance. These devices soften the supply by replacing calcium and magnesium ions with sodium ions, significantly reducing scale accumulation.
Method | Description | Effectiveness |
---|---|---|
Descaling Agents | Commercial products designed to dissolve mineral deposits. | High |
Vinegar Solutions | Natural acid for softening and removing scale. | Moderate |
Water Softeners | Systems that minimize mineral content in the supply. | Very High |
